The lines for lockers are not usually long when we are there. Any cash register in the stores can rent keys...people tend to bunch up at the first one they see, so sometimes peeking a little further will save you some waiting.

We also tend to go first thing when the park opens and then have our fun until lunch time and then split to the Earl of Sandwich at DD for lunch. By that time the water park is getting crowded with long lines and we don't want to be there anyway. Probably not as much an issue in September.

We get there, get a locker, stuff everything in the locker except for a bag with some towels and some water and snacks. A different bag is in the locker with shampoo, clothes to change into later, etc., after a shower when we are leaving. If the park has just opened, we then head off to our favorite ride, parking our towel/snacks bag someplace handy. After we're tired of doing our favorite ride over and over, we find a centrally located permanent place to leave the towels and stuff and head off to do more rides. We come back for water and snacks a few times.

One thing to remember about the water park is to keep hydrated...it sounds crazy but with all the exertion in the Florida heat you need to keep drinking water even though you're wallowing in the stuff!

Once we've had enough for the day (lazy river is usually our last wind-down ride) we pack up for the showers, get dressed, and head for lunch and a break before tackling another park.
